Boisterous
Boisterous adjective - Being rough or noisy in a high-spirited way.
Festive and boisterous are semantically related. In some cases you can use "Festive" instead an adjective "Boisterous".

Festive
Festive adjective - Indicative of or marked by high spirits or good humor.
Boisterous and festive are semantically related. Sometimes you can use "Boisterous" instead an adjective "Festive".
